Elon, McFadden Share Tournament Title

The second and final round of the 11th Annual Great Smokies Intercollegiate was cancelled due to heavy rains in the area. The Elon Phoenix and host Western Carolina Catamounts were declared the co-champions after each squad carded a first round total of 286 on Saturday from the Waynesville Inn – Golf Resort and Spa. Elon's Tara McFadden was one of four co-individual winners with a first round score of 69. Full Game Story

McFadden, Davis Help Elon to Fourth-Place Finish

Tara McFadden and Diana Davis each finished in the top 10 to lead the Elon women's golf team to a fourth-place finish at the Sea Trail Women's Intercollegiate. McFadden posted a three-round score of 223 (76-74-73) to finish in a tie for fifth while Davis placed eighth with a final score of 225 (74-76-75). Western Carolina took home the team title with a score of 897 while Longwood placed second (898) and Samford finished third (908). Full Game Story

McFadden Ties Event Record to Win ECU's Tournament

Elon's Tara McFadden followed up her tournament-record tying second round of 66 with a third round 72 and finished with a 52-hole score of 211 as she won the individual title at the 2009 Lady Pirate Intercollegiate tournament on Tuesday. Her three-round total also tied a tournament record. McFadden's efforts helped the Phoenix to a fifth-place finish in a 15-team field which included nine top-100 programs. Full Game Story

Johnson Leads Elon to Mimosa Hills Title

Kelsey Johnson's two-round score of 150 helped lead the Elon women's golf team to its first team title of the season as the Phoenix won the Mimosa Hills Intercollegiate by three strokes over Southern Conference rival Appalachian State. Elon posted a two-day total of 607 (305-302) to lead the 15-team field. Elon led the field with a 4.22 stroke average on par four holes and was tied for third with 18 birdies. Full Game Story

McFadden, Davis Earn SoCon Honors; Elon Places Sixth

Tara McFadden was recognized with All-Southern Conference honors while teammate Diana Davis earned a spot on the Southern Conference All-Freshman Team following the 2010 Southern Conference Women's Golf Championship. The duo helped lead Elon to a sixth-place tie with a three-round score of 945 (322-300-323) at the league showcase. Davis was Elon's top finisher, placing in a tie for 12th with a score of 230 (76-72-82). Davis recorded 32 pars and five birdies throughout the event. Full Game Story
